Merl M. Huntsinger (BU 47), who retired from Washington University in St. Louis in 1981 as treasurer and secretary, died Friday, Nov. 2, 2012, in a New Orleans hospital. He was 97. Huntsinger began his career at the university as an internal auditor immediately after graduating from Olin Business School. He became comptroller in 1967, was promoted to treasurer a year later, and took on the additional responsibility of secretary to the Board of Trustees in 1973. He retired in 1981.
